PDA

Просмотр полной версии : [Вопрос] Помогите решить варнинг



Andrik851
08.04.2019, 18:33
у меня команда показать паспорт в ней варниг и когда показываешь паспорт все данные смещены на одну строку вниз

вот варнинг


D:\ÑÅÐÂÅÐÀ\ëîêàëüíûé ñåðâåð\gamemodes\mrpv1.pwn(35349) : warning 213: tag mismatch: expected tag "bool", but found none ("_")
Pawn compiler 3.10.8 Copyright (c) 1997-2006, ITB CompuPhase

Header size: 19672 bytes
Code size: 6160264 bytes
Data size: 7635328 bytes
Stack/heap size: 16384 bytes; estimated max. usage=7264 cells (29056 bytes)
Total requirements:13831648 bytes

1 Warning.


вместо ранга пишется организация и так далее


вот сама команда



CMD:pass(playerid, params[])
{
if(PlayerLogged[playerid] == 0) return true;
if(sscanf(params, "i", params[0])) return SendClientMessage(playerid, COLOR_WHITE, "Введите: /pass [id игрока]");
if(!IsPlayerConnected(params[0])) return SendClientMessage(playerid, COLOR_GREY, TPLAYEROFFLINE);
if(PlayerLogged[params[0]] == 0) return SendClientMessage(playerid, COLOR_GREY, TPLAYERNLOGGED);
if(!IsPlayerInRangeOfPlayer(8.0, playerid, params[0])) return SendClientMessage(playerid, COLOR_GREY, "Игрок слишком далеко!");
new string[128],coordsstring[256],gtext[32],text[16],
ttexttt[32],mtext[16];
format(gtext,sizeof(gtext),"Гражданин");
if(PlayerInfo[playerid][pPhone][0] == 0) format(text, sizeof(text), "Нет");
else format(text, sizeof(text), "%i", PlayerInfo[playerid][pPhone][1]);
if((PlayerInfo[playerid][pVb]) == 0) format(ttexttt,sizeof(ttexttt),"Не имеется");
else format(ttexttt,sizeof(ttexttt),"Имеется");
if(PlayerInfo[playerid][pMarried] == false) format(mtext, sizeof(mtext), "Нет");
else format(mtext, sizeof(mtext), "%s", PlayerInfo[playerid][pWhoMarried]);
new msg[] = "Имя: %s\nПроживание в штате: %i\nГражданство: %s\nТелефон: %s\nВоенный билет: %s\nБрак: \nОрганизация: %s\nРанг: %s\nПреступлений: %i\nУровень розыска: %i";
format(coordsstring, 512, msg, PlayerInfo[playerid][pSendername],PlayerInfo[playerid][
pLevel],gtext,text,mtext,ttexttt,GetFracName(playerid),GetRangName(playerid),PlayerInfo[
playerid][pCrimes], PlayerInfo[playerid][pWanted]);
SPD(params[0], D_NULL, DIALOG_STYLE_MSGBOX, "Паспорт 6012 №758091", coordsstring, "Закрыть", "");
format(string, 64, "%s показал(a) свой паспорт %s", PlayerInfo[playerid][pSendername], sendername(params[0]));
ProxDetectorNew(playerid, 30.0, COLOR_PURPLE, string);
return true;
}

ihNNNNNify
08.04.2019, 18:46
CMD:pass(playerid, params[])
{
if(PlayerLogged[playerid] == 0) return true;
if(sscanf(params, "i", params[0])) return SendClientMessage(playerid, COLOR_WHITE, "Введите: /pass [id игрока]");
if(!IsPlayerConnected(params[0])) return SendClientMessage(playerid, COLOR_GREY, TPLAYEROFFLINE);
if(PlayerLogged[params[0]] == 0) return SendClientMessage(playerid, COLOR_GREY, TPLAYERNLOGGED);
if(!IsPlayerInRangeOfPlayer(8.0, playerid, params[0])) return SendClientMessage(playerid, COLOR_GREY, "Игрок слишком далеко!");
new string[128],coordsstring[256],gtext[32],text[16],
ttexttt[32],mtext[16];
format(gtext,sizeof(gtext),"Гражданин");
if(PlayerInfo[playerid][pPhone][0] == 0) format(text, sizeof(text), "Нет");
else format(text, sizeof(text), "%i", PlayerInfo[playerid][pPhone][1]);
if((PlayerInfo[playerid][pVb]) == 0) format(ttexttt,sizeof(ttexttt),"Не имеется");
else format(ttexttt,sizeof(ttexttt),"Имеется");
if(PlayerInfo[playerid][pMarried] == 0) format(mtext, sizeof(mtext), "Нет");
else format(mtext, sizeof(mtext), "%s", PlayerInfo[playerid][pWhoMarried]);
new msg[] = "Имя: %s\nПроживание в штате: %i\nГражданство: %s\nТелефон: %s\nВоенный билет: %s\nБрак: \nОрганизация: %s\nРанг: %s\nПреступлений: %i\nУровень розыска: %i";
format(coordsstring, sizeof(coordsstring), msg, PlayerInfo[playerid][pSendername],
PlayerInfo[playerid][pLevel],gtext,text,mtext,ttexttt,GetFracName(playerid),GetRangName(playerid),
PlayerInfo[playerid][pCrimes], PlayerInfo[playerid][pWanted]);
SPD(params[0], D_NULL, DIALOG_STYLE_MSGBOX, "Паспорт 6012 №758091", coordsstring, "Закрыть", "");
format(string, 64, "%s показал(a) свой паспорт %s", PlayerInfo[playerid][pSendername], sendername(params[0]));
ProxDetectorNew(playerid, 30.0, COLOR_PURPLE, string);
return true;
}

Andrik851
09.04.2019, 11:21
проблема решена тему можно закрывать